读书人

是不是写成 varchar(8000) 要比 nvarc

发布时间: 2012-02-21 16:26:23 作者: rapoo

是不是写成 varchar(8000) 要比 nvarchar(4000) 能够写更长的SQL字串?
Declare @sql nvarchar(4000)


假设有一个SQL 字串拼接,很长很长
超过4000 怎么办? 是不是写成 varchar(8000) 要比 nvarchar(4000) 能够写更长的SQL字串?

[解决办法]
Declare @sql1 nvarchar(4000),@sql2 nvarchar(4000),...,@sqln nvarchar(4000)

exec(@sql1+@sql2+...+@sqln)

读书人网 >SQL Server

热点推荐